Dorchester party ends with three shot

Boston Police report three men were shot at a party at 31 Hecla St. around 11:30 p.m. on Friday.

One of the victims suffered life-threatening injuries; the other two managed to run to Adams Street a half block away, where police found them.



Good to know Hecla street is

By on

Good to know Hecla street is still a shit-hole after 20 years. :\

Voting is closed. 23